Step #0. General information about how the VK group menus are structured

The menu for the group is made from wiki pages, the creation of which is supported by VK. Wiki pages are special pages that can only be created in public pages. They differ from regular posts in that they can use so-called wiki markup. This markup is special code that is converted into additional formatting objects. To make it clearer, let us explain. For example, in regular posts you can use only plain text, but wiki markup allows you to highlight parts of the text in bold or italics. That is, she enters additional features registration In particular, the ability to post images, when clicked on, the user will be redirected to a link. It is these additional formatting options that are used to create the VK public menu. We will tell you exactly how to do this below.

Step 1. Preparatory stage

If you have an existing group, we recommend creating a new one. For testing and experiments. Otherwise, during the learning process, you risk inundating your subscribers with strange and unnecessary updates.

So you've created new group. Let's now find out the identifier (ID) of your group. The group ID is its unique VKontakte number. Go to your group and click on “Community Posts” (if there are no posts in the group, then “No Posts” will appear instead of “Community Posts”). In You will go to new page with an address like this:

https://vk.com/wall- XXX?own=1

Instead of XXX you will have a set of numbers (and only numbers!). This is your community ID. For example, in our test group this is 154457305.

Now let's create a new wiki page in the group. To do this, we will create a link like this:

http://vk.com/pages?oid=- group_id&p= Page_name

http://vk.com/pages?oid=- 154457305 &p= Menu

Open the resulting link in your browser (copy it into the address bar of your browser and go to the address). That's it, you have created a wiki page called “Menu” (if, of course, you specified “Menu” as the page name in the link). You should see text like this: “The Menu page is empty. Fill it with content." In the upper right corner there is a pencil icon (). Click on it to go to editing the page.

The VK wiki page editor has two modes: graphic and markup mode. Modes are switched using the button in the upper right part of the editor (). When the button is highlighted in blue, it means that markup mode is enabled. The visual editing mode is more convenient, because allows you to do without knowledge of wiki markup syntax, but its functionality is extremely limited: you can only do the simplest things in it. Basically you will have to deal with markup mode.

Notice two things. Firstly, to the left of the button for switching editing modes there is a call button reference information according to wiki markup (). Very useful thing, especially for beginners. The second point you need to pay attention to is the address of the wiki page. IN address bar in your browser you will see something like this:

http://vk.com/page-group_id _XXX?act=edit§ion=edit

Part of the address before the "?" - this is the address of your wiki page. Write it down somewhere: in VK there is no way to see a list of your wiki pages and links to them. To go to the one you need, you need to know its address or use the link to create a wiki page again. Using last method keep in mind that pages, if they already exist, are not recreated.

Step #2. Making a simple menu for a VKontakte group

So, we have created a wiki page “Menu”. Go to the editor's markup mode and add the following code:

Click on the “Preview” button, which is located at the bottom of the editor. You should see a list of three links. The first two are external and lead to the main pages of Yandex and Google, respectively. The third link is internal. It leads to a public VK with ID “1” (this is the official VK group for developers). If your preview displays your code, and not links (which you can click on) - it means you entered the code in visual editing mode, and not in markup mode. Be careful!

Please note that external links in the VK wiki code are formatted with single brackets, and internal links with double brackets. In this case, internal VK links are indicated not as the usual website address, but as a pointer to a particular VK object. For example, a pointer to a group has the following form:

club group_id

On VKontakte there are pointers not only to groups, but also to individual photographs, posts, wiki pages, user pages, audio recordings, etc. Each index has its own recording form. We'll use some of them later and look at them in more detail.

Be sure to save the page. Basically, we've just created a very basic navigation page. Which is nothing more than the simplest menu for VKontakte group. Of course, this is not a graphical menu yet, but even it can cope with the main task of the menu - quickly direct users to the desired public location. Step #3. Where can I post VKontakte wiki pages?

There are two main places: you can create a post with a link to the wiki page or post it in the “Materials” section of your community.

Let's start with the first option. Start adding new entry on your group wall. First, attach any photo to it. It is better to take a fairly large photo whose width is greater than its height. Then paste into the text the record being created a link to the wiki page you created with a simple menu. This is what we asked you to write down a little earlier. Let us remind you that the link looks like this ( you will have different numbers):

http://vk.com/page-121237693_72827423

Now delete text links from the input field. The link itself under the photo will not disappear. But if you leave the link address in the text field, it will appear as text in the post. Publish the post, reload the browser page with the main page of your group and pin the created post. Reload the page again. As a result of these manipulations, you should get something like this:

Click on the photo in the pinned post: your wiki page should appear with a simple group menu.

So, we learned that wiki pages can be attached to posts. In particular - to the assigned post. The second place where you can use wiki markup is the “Materials” section.

Go to the community settings and find there managing community sections (services). Mark "Materials" as "Restricted". A new item will now appear at the top of your community's home page. It is located to the right of the “Information” item. When you first turn on materials in a group, this item is called “Latest News” by default. This is what it looks like:

Go to this new item. Click on the “Edit” checkbox. As a result, you will find yourself in the wiki page editor you are already familiar with. The only difference is that there is an input field for the page name. Change it from "Latest News" to "Menu2". IN markup editing mode enter the following code:

"""Menu option for the "Materials" section"""


[]

Make a preview (links already familiar to us should appear) and save the page. Essentially, this page is the main (root) wiki page of your group. True, there is no special practical meaning in this difference from other wiki pages.

Go to home page your group, reboot it and see what happens. We recommend viewing your group from a mobile browser and from the VK application. You will notice that the arrangement of elements and the operating logic are slightly different everywhere. You need to have a good understanding of what belongs to what and where it is shown.

We learned that the menu can be placed in two places. It is preferable to make it both as a pinned post and in the “Materials” section. Remember two things:

  • The pinned post will be seen by 98% of your visitors, and only 25-40% of the most curious will get to the materials section, as well as loyal old users of your group who know that there is something useful there.
  • A pinned entry with a picture to open the menu can be supplemented with text. This way you won't lose this pinned post feature. But you shouldn’t overdo it either: the more text, the lower the link to open your menu will be.

The vertical graphic menu in VK is an image cut into strips. These stripes are placed with markings one below the other on the wiki page. Some of these "lanes" are assigned links. When you click on such a link image, you actually follow this link. One page is one link. Some bands (for example, intermediate ones, which are located between points), on the contrary, are assigned the absence of a link. Such stripes become “unclickable”.

Making a vertical graphic menu for a VK group comes down to the following sequence of actions:

  • The first thing you need to do is draw a menu. The width must be strictly 600px(pixels). We recommend making the menu no more than 900px in height. The result is best saved in PNG format, as a last resort - JPG. Use drawing tools that are familiar and convenient to you (such as Photoshop or GIMP). The result here depends 95% on your creative and technical skills. Even if you don’t know how to use graphic editors at all, don’t despair. The skills that will be sufficient can be acquired in a maximum of a couple of hours. There is a huge amount of reference and educational information on the Internet. In addition, the ability to use a graphic editor at least a little is very, very useful for public administrators. You won't waste your time.
  • Next, the picture with the menu is cut into horizontal stripes. You can do this in any way convenient for you: from the familiar Photoshop to various online services. If you have no idea how to do this, just ask your favorite search engine. We will not describe in detail the technical part of the cutting process: there are dozens of methods, some are suitable for some users, but not for others. When cutting, you must follow one simple rule: the height of one strip should not be less than 60px. Otherwise, you may have problems with displaying the menu in the application and in mobile browsers: so-called. "white stripes" between images.
  • The cut "strips" are uploaded to the group album or album on the group admin page. We recommend the second option. In any case, an album with cut-out parts of the menu should be V open access . Otherwise, those users for whom album images are not available will not see your menu!
  • Wiki markup code is compiled and inserted into the desired wiki page.
  • The group contains a pinned post with an image link to a wiki page with a menu. We wrote in detail above about how such a post is made. Three types of VKontakte menu

  • settings menu;
  • main side;
  • menu of sections or pages of VKontakte;

Each of them is responsible for either certain settings, or for certain actions. With their help, you can configure your profile or individual actions, as well as simply navigate through sections.

Page settings menu

Access to it is in the upper right part of the page - where the miniature of our avatar is located. To activate, you just need to click on the thumbnail and a drop-down list will open.

What can you do here? do or change? In the “Edit” section you can fill in or. In the “Settings” section you can configure parameters such as, etc. If you suddenly have any questions about the site, go to the “Help” section, select the desired section and read the information. To quickly find the answer you need, use the search in the help sections.

The last item “Exit” allows you to end the current session. How to leave VKontakte on various devices, described.

All user page settings and profile information are configured through this menu. As a rule, all these actions are performed at . If you have just recently created a page on VK, then we advise you to set up and fill out your profile, and at the same time understand all the sections of this menu (see the articles linked above).

Main menu. VKontakte pages and access to them.

The side menu is the basis of work and navigation on the site. All the main VKontakte pages are collected here. let's consider full list sections and find out who is responsible for what.

  • Games. The name speaks for itself. All games of the VKontakte social network are located here, and the latest games that you and your friends played (and what they achieved in these games) are also displayed;
  • Goods. Here is a list of all products that are sold on the social network. You can use the search to find required product, and you can also add your own product.

Last two sections - “Bookmarks” And "Documentation" disabled by default. In a nutshell... Bookmarks displays photos, videos, products or news that you like (and like). You can also add interesting people or interesting links to bookmarks so that you can quickly find them later. “Documents” displays all attachments that you sent in messages or any documents that you uploaded to the site. As a rule, most users do not particularly need these sections, so they are not initially displayed by default, but you can always add them there if you wish. How to make a “VKontakte” menu

You can add or exclude some items from the main side menu. It should be remembered that there are sections that cannot be removed from there. These include sections:

  • My page;
  • News;
  • Messages;
  • Friends

All other items can be added to or removed from the main menu at your discretion. This is done simply. Go to the settings menu, “Settings”, “General” tab.

Next we go to the item settings window. Here we can check the boxes next to the items we want to display. When the required sections are selected, all that remains is to click the “Save” button. As we have already said, the first four points are mandatory and cannot be disabled.

Personal messages from the community

Surely everyone has already seen the “Write a message” button and knows about community messages. This function allows you to establish feedback with the community administration. While administrators might not notice a comment under a news story a month ago or in one of a dozen discussions, it’s hard not to notice a +1 in community messages.

To start using this feature, you must enable it. The settings for this section are located in the “messages” tab in community management.

It's cool that you can write a greeting message. You can also add a group to the left menu of the social network, where +1 will appear opposite the community when you receive a new message to the group.

Fortunately, Vkontakte has the ability to create wiki pages. Using such a wiki page, we can create a community menu, and then pin this menu to the top of the group.

So, let's take it in order.

How to create a wiki page?

1. Create a link like this in the address bar of your browser:

  • xxx– id of your group or public page;
  • Page_name– any word you use to name your page.

How to find out your community ID? If the id is not contained in the link, for example, https://vk.com/make_community, you can find it out as follows. Click on the title of the group wall, where the number of publications is written.

Your community wall will open separately. There will be numbers in the address bar. This is your community id.


2.
Follow the link you created and click “Fill with content.”

3. Fill your page with content. For example, we need a graphical menu in the form of separate buttons. First we create the entire image.

Then we cut it into separate buttons. In this particular case, we should have four button images.

We return to our page and, using the built-in editor, load our button images.

After loading all the images it should look like this:

By clicking on any of the pictures, you can specify a link to the page where this menu item will lead. This can be either your community page or a page on an external website or online store.
